Mixed Ending to Week for Asia

Stocks in Asia-Pacific were mixed on Friday, with the price of bitcoin tumbling below $49,000 U.S.

The Nikkei 225 docked 167.54 points, or 0.6%, to 29,020.63.

The Japanese yen traded at 107.91 per U.S. dollar, still stronger than levels above 108.4 against the greenback seen earlier this week.

In Hong Kong, the Hang Seng index advanced 323.41 points, or 1.1%, to 29,078.75.

Meanwhile, bitcoin prices dropped below the $49,000 level. As of 3:33 a.m. ET Friday, the price of bitcoin sat at $48,470.05, according to data from Coin Metrics.

The Australian dollar changed hands at $0.7735, following its slip yesterday from around $0.776.

In other markets

In Shanghai, the CSI 300 regained 46.21 points, or 0.9%, to 5,135.45

In Singapore, the Straits Times index edged ahead 6.26 points, or 0.2%, to 3,194.04.

In Korea, the Kospi index gained 8.58 points, or 0.3%, to 3,186.10.

In Taiwan, the Taiex index climbed 203.3 points, or 1.2%, to 17,300.27

In New Zealand, the NZX 50 strengthened 73.16 points, or 0.6%, to 12,650.64.

In Australia, the ASX 200 picked up 5.26 points, or 0.1%, to 7,060.71.
